Navigating Innovation: The Role of Regulatory Sandboxes

Regulatory sandboxes offer a novel approach to fostering financial technology growth while mitigating potential risks to consumers. These controlled environments allow businesses to test new products and services in a simulated setting, under the supervision of regulators. By providing this platform, sandboxes can help promote innovation while ensuring that consumer interests remain paramount.

The benefits of regulatory sandboxes are wide-ranging. For companies, they provide a valuable opportunity to test their ideas in a real-world setting, reducing the risk of failure and attracting investment. Regulators, on the other hand, can monitor these new products and services closely, identifying potential issues early on and implementing necessary modifications. This collaborative approach fosters a dynamic ecosystem where innovation can flourish while safeguarding consumer confidence.
